Section 12.506. Appeal From Suspension, Refusal, or Revocation of License or Permit

Sec. 12.506. APPEAL FROM SUSPENSION, REFUSAL, OR REVOCATION OF LICENSE OR PERMIT. (a) An appeal from an order of the department refusing to issue or transfer a license or permit or revoking or suspending a license or permit may be taken to a district court of Travis County.
(b) The appeal shall be under the substantial evidence rule and against the department alone as defendant.
(c) This section does not apply to the appeal of a decision by the department refusing to issue or renew a permit to which Subchapter G applies.
Added by Acts 1985, 69th Leg., ch. 267, art. 1, Sec. 36, eff. Sept. 1, 1985. Amended by Acts 1999, 76th Leg., ch. 454, Sec. 2, 3, eff. Sept. 1, 1999.
Amended by:
Acts 2013, 83rd Leg., R.S., Ch. 99 (S.B. 820), Sec. 2, eff. September 1, 2013.
